What types of dates are used on food products?

0

“Sell-By” date tells the store owner/operator how long to display the product for sale. You should buy the product before the date. “Best if used by” date is recommended for best flavor or quality. This is not a purchase or safety date. “Use-By” date is the last date recommended for the use of the product while at peak quality. This date is determined by the manufacturer. “Closed or coded dates” are packing numbers for manufacturer’s use.
